Finding another use for chicken parts that aren't usually eaten is not a new thing. Here in the Philippines, isaw (chicken intestines), helmet (chicken head) and adidas (chicken feet, named after the athletic shoe company) are popular … Continue reading 178 – On Chicken Parts Flying High: Wingstop, Fairview Terraces
